The GlimmIr: Spectroscopic Variability in a z~7 LRD Indicates Rapid Changes in Both the Narrow and Broad Line Regions
First spectroscopic variability in a z~7 LRD shows rapid changes in both narrow and broad line regions, implying direct ionization from the central source to surrounding nebular gas.

Active Galactic Nuclei-driven Metallicity Enrichment in the Interstellar Medium of Mrk 573
AGN activity in Mrk 573 enriches the surrounding gas with metals up to several times solar abundance on 100-parsec scales via outflows and jets.
